Summary

Rice Intermediate/Middle School in Rice, TX, serves 321 students in grades 5 through 8 within the Rice Independent School District (Isd), and has shown impressive academic growth over the past decade, climbing from the 31st percentile to the 58th percentile statewide.

This school stands out as a "math school" in the region, consistently outperforming the state average in mathematics across most grade levels. For example, 5th graders scored 67.44% proficient in math compared to the state average of 47.38%, a 20-point advantage. This strength is particularly notable when compared to nearby schools like Scurry-Rosser Middle and Alamo Middle, which often struggle in this subject. While Palmer Middle is the highest-performing nearby school overall, Rice is highly competitive in math, even outperforming Palmer in 5th grade math (67.44% vs. 51.11%). The school also excels with its Gifted and Talented students, ranking in the 70th percentile statewide.

However, the school faces significant challenges. It serves a student population with a very high rate of economic disadvantage (86.92% on free/reduced lunch), which is higher than all nearby schools including Corsicana Middle and Ennis J H. Most concerning is a sharp decline in support for Special Education students, who ranked in the 2nd percentile statewide in the most recent year—a catastrophic drop from the 44th percentile the year prior. This suggests a systemic issue that requires immediate attention. While the school is effective for students whose primary challenge is poverty (ranking in the 63rd percentile for low socio-economic status), it struggles to support students facing a wider array of risk factors, creating a polarized performance profile that leaves some groups critically behind.
